Types of QA Roles You Can Find
When you're on the lookout for a quality assurance vacancy in Pune, it's super helpful to know the different types of roles available. The QA landscape is pretty diverse, guys, and it's not just about clicking around and finding bugs anymore. We're talking about a spectrum of responsibilities that cater to various skill sets and interests. First up, you have the Manual Testers. These are the folks who meticulously execute test cases, explore the application, and report defects. They're the hands-on explorers of the software, ensuring everything behaves as expected. If you have a keen eye for detail and a patient approach, this could be your jam. Then there are the Automation Testers. This is a rapidly growing field, and for good reason! Automation testers write scripts and use tools to automate repetitive testing tasks. This requires programming skills, knowledge of automation frameworks (like Selenium, Appium, Cypress), and a good understanding of how to optimize the testing process. If you love coding and problem-solving, this is where the action is. You'll often see job descriptions asking for skills in languages like Python, Java, or JavaScript. Next, we have Performance Testers. These specialists focus on how an application performs under various loads and conditions. They use tools like JMeter or LoadRunner to identify bottlenecks, measure response times, and ensure the system can handle peak user traffic. This role is crucial for applications that need to be highly scalable and reliable. If you're into understanding system architecture and how things perform under pressure, this is a great niche. We also have Security Testers (often called Ethical Hackers or Penetration Testers). Their job is to find vulnerabilities in the software that could be exploited by malicious actors. This requires a deep understanding of cybersecurity principles and often involves specialized tools and techniques. It's a high-stakes, high-reward role. Beyond these, you might encounter Test Leads or QA Managers. These roles involve leading a team of testers, planning test strategies, managing resources, and ensuring the overall quality process is effective. These positions are for those with leadership experience and a strategic mindset. And let's not forget QA Analysts and QA Engineers, which can encompass a broad range of responsibilities, often blending manual and automated testing, working closely with developers, and contributing to the entire software development lifecycle. Skills You'll Need to Land a QA Job in Pune
Alright, let's talk brass tacks: what skills do you actually need to snag one of those coveted quality assurance vacancy in Pune? It's not just about having a degree, though that helps. Companies are really looking for a blend of technical prowess, analytical thinking, and solid soft skills. Firstly, technical skills are paramount. For manual testing roles, you need a deep understanding of different testing methodologies – think black-box, white-box, gray-box testing, regression testing, smoke testing, and usability testing. You should be adept at writing clear, concise, and effective test cases and bug reports. Familiarity with bug tracking tools like Jira, Bugzilla, or Asana is usually a must-have. For automation roles, the game changes. You absolutely need proficiency in at least one programming language – Python, Java, and JavaScript are incredibly popular. Knowledge of popular automation frameworks like Selenium WebDriver, Appium (for mobile), Cypress, or Playwright is often non-negotiable. Understanding CI/CD tools like Jenkins or GitLab CI is also a huge advantage, as it shows you understand how testing fits into the broader development pipeline. Beyond specific tools, analytical and problem-solving skills are the bedrock of any good QA professional. You need to be able to look at software, understand how it's supposed to work, and then systematically figure out why it's not working. This involves critical thinking, attention to detail, and the ability to break down complex problems into manageable parts. Communication skills are surprisingly crucial too, guys. You'll be working with developers, product managers, and sometimes even clients. Being able to clearly articulate bugs, explain technical issues, and provide constructive feedback is vital. This includes both written and verbal communication. Domain knowledge can also give you a significant edge. If you're applying for a QA role in a FinTech company, having some understanding of financial markets or regulations is a massive plus. Similarly, for gaming or healthcare tech, domain expertise matters. Lastly, don't underestimate the importance of soft skills. Things like teamwork, adaptability, a willingness to learn, and a positive attitude go a long way. The tech landscape is always changing, so being someone who embraces learning new tools and techniques will make you a highly valuable asset. Preparing for Your QA Interview in Pune
So, you've found a promising quality assurance vacancy in Pune and landed an interview. Awesome! Now, the crucial part: preparing to ace it. Interviews for QA roles, especially in a competitive market like Pune, can be pretty rigorous, guys. You need to be ready for a mix of technical questions, behavioral questions, and sometimes even practical exercises. First things first, research the company thoroughly. Understand their products or services, their market position, their company culture, and any recent news. This shows genuine interest and helps you tailor your answers. Next, brush up on your core QA concepts. Be ready to explain different testing types, the software development lifecycle (SDLC), and the role of QA within it. Understand the difference between verification and validation. Be prepared to discuss your experience with various testing methodologies like Agile, Scrum, or Waterfall. Practice common interview questions. For technical roles, expect questions about SQL queries (especially if the role involves database testing), basic programming concepts (if it's an automation role), API testing (tools like Postman), and understanding of test automation principles. They might ask you to design test cases for a specific scenario – for example, testing a login page or a shopping cart. Think aloud as you walk them through your thought process. Prepare for behavioral questions using the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result). These questions assess your soft skills and how you handle different work situations. Think about times you've faced challenges, resolved conflicts, worked in a team, or identified a critical bug. For instance, "Tell me about a time you found a significant bug" or "How do you handle disagreements with developers?" If there's a practical test or coding challenge, make sure you've practiced. If it's automation, be ready to write a simple script or debug existing code. If it's manual, you might be asked to perform exploratory testing on a given application or document test cases. Prepare your own questions to ask the interviewer. This shows engagement and helps you gather information about the role, the team, and the company culture. Ask about the team structure, the typical day-to-day responsibilities, the tools they use, and opportunities for growth.
